About 2027 E N St

What a transformation to this totally updated duplex! Each side offers 2 bedrooms, 1 bath with nearly 1000 square feet on the lower level featuring a garage, laundry and loads of extra storage which would make a great workshop! Very open living area with all new kitchen and baths. Very private back yard with extra parking and a great place to BBQ or just relax. Superb location convenient to downtown, I385, Bob Jones University and much more. Easy to show and look for floor plan in associated documents!

Living in Greenville, SC

Greenville's transport infrastructure supports both private and public transit options, with a network of roads and highways that facilitate commuting and travel within the city and to neighboring areas. Public transportation services are available, providing connectivity across different parts of the city. The community is also attentive to the needs of pedestrians and cyclists, with areas that are particularly friendly to walking and biking. Ongoing initiatives aim to enhance transport efficiency and accessibility, ensuring that residents and visitors can navigate the city with ease.

The community benefits from a comprehensive educational system, with a number of public and private schools that cater to various educational needs, from elementary to high school levels. Greenville also boasts several higher education institutions, contributing to the city's focus on learning and development. Healthcare services are well-represented, with major hospitals and clinics providing a range of medical care. The city's public library system supports lifelong learning, while the retail and dining landscape reflects the local culture, offering everything from boutique shops to diverse culinary experiences.

Greenville is celebrated for its vibrant downtown and the scenic beauty of its surrounding areas. The community prides itself on a rich cultural scene, with numerous local events and festivals that highlight the city's artistic and historical heritage. The character of Greenville is defined by its blend of urban amenities and charming green spaces, creating an environment that appeals to both city dwellers and nature enthusiasts alike.

Greenville, South Carolina, offers a diverse housing market with a blend of architectural styles that cater to a range of preferences. The housing landscape is predominantly composed of single-family homes, which feature prominently in the city's residential areas. These homes vary in design, showcasing modern, traditional, and craftsman influences. Apartments and townhouses are also available, providing options for those seeking a more urban living experience. The homeownership rate in Greenville is robust, reflecting a community invested in long-term residency and stability.
